question:
What is the EVH Guitar Potentiometer Low Friction 250K Split Shaft used for?
répondre: The EVH Guitar Potentiometer Low Friction 250K Split Shaft is designed for electric guitars, specifically for tone or volume control. This type of potentiometer is crucial as it regulates the electrical signal from the guitar's pickups to the amplifier, impacting both volume levels and tonal characteristics. The low friction feature ensures smooth operation, enabling players to make subtle adjustments while performing. Whether you’re a rock guitarist looking to shape your sound or a blues musician needing dynamic control, this potentiometer enhances your playing experience. -

question:
Is the 250K split shaft potentiometer suitable for all types of electric guitars?
répondre: The 250K split shaft potentiometer is particularly suitable for passive pickups commonly found in electric guitars, such as those used in rock or blues genres. While it can be used on most electric guitars, it’s essential to consider the type of pickups installed. For instance, if your guitar has humbucker pickups, a 500K potentiometer might be better as it allows more high frequencies. However, for single-coil pickups, the 250K provides a warm tone with smooth highs. Always ensure compatibility to optimize your guitar's performance. -

question:
What are the advantages of using split shaft potentiometers over solid shaft?
répondre: Split shaft potentiometers, such as the EVH model, are designed to accommodate knobs that have a set screw, allowing for a secure fit that can easily be adjusted or replaced. This design is advantageous because it offers versatile knob options for customization. In comparison, solid shaft models require a tight fit and are more difficult to modify. Musicians often prefer split shafts for their ease of use when swapping out knobs, whether for aesthetic reasons or functional preferences during performances. -

question:
How does a potentiometer affect the overall tone of an electric guitar?
répondre: The potentiometer plays a significant role in shaping an electric guitar's tone by controlling the amount of signal that passes from the guitar's pickups to the output. Lower impedance potentiometers, such as the 250K model, can mellow out brighter tones, making them ideal for single-coil pickups. This creates a warmer sound, while higher impedance pots can enhance brightness for humbuckers. Understanding how to manipulate your potentiometer settings allows players to discover various tones that suit their style or genre. -
question:
Do I need any special tools for installation?
répondre: To install the EVH Guitar Potentiometer, you'll typically need basic tools like a soldering iron, solder, wire cutters, and possibly a screwdriver for disassembly. Having a multimeter can also be beneficial to test electrical connections before and after installation. While advanced guitar technicians might have specialized equipment, these basic tools are usually sufficient for proper installation. Ensuring you have the right tools beforehand will make the installation process smoother and more efficient. -

question:
What maintenance should I perform on potentiometers?
répondre: Maintaining your potentiometers involves ensuring they stay clean and operating smoothly. Regularly check for dust or debris that might hinder their function, and if needed, you can use contact cleaner to maintain performance. Additionally, keep an eye out for any electrical issues, such as crackling noises when turning the knob, which may indicate a need for replacement. Regular maintenance not only prolongs the life of the potentiometer but also ensures consistent sound quality during play.

Caractéristiques et avantages
- Developed by Eddie Van Halen for seamless volume swells.
- Available in 250K or 500K value audio taper potentiometers.
- Ultra-smooth action ideal for on-the-go tonal adjustments.
- Compatible with push-on-style control knobs.
- Features a longer-life brass bushing and ±10% resistance tolerance.
- Includes mounting hardware for easy installation and custom height adjustment.
